The All-African People’s Revolutionary Party (A-APRP) has launched the 100th anniversary of the birth of our founder, the immortal Osagyefo Dr. Kwame Nkrumah born on September 21, 1909. Dr. Nkrumah was a true Pan-Africanist and internationalist, fighting against capitalism and imperialism in all corners of the world. His contributions, both conceptually and practically, serve as a shinning example of how to achieve justice and peace in this world.
In January of 2009, the world wide community called for unified efforts to acknowledge and commemorate the life, works and continued contributions of Nkrumah and Nkrumahists and since then there have been global events underway.
